Athletic training platform exercise device
10639515 · 2020-05-05 ·

A multi-purpose athletic training platform exercise device is provided. A user may stand atop a platform and exercise while connected to a downward pulling source of resistance. This machine allows the user to walk forwards, backwards and side-to-side freely while still having attachment to the resistance source via a connecting means. This will activate all the muscles in the lower body while tractioning the lower back and helping to reduce pelvic tilt. The resistance may be varied during the user effort. The user is able to step off the machine to climb up or down a step, or walk up and down a ramp that may be provided.

Training apparatus

A training apparatus includes exercise equipment mounted to a side surface or a roof of a land vehicle or for mounting to a surface such as a wall of a building or a ship. The exercise equipment includes a support structure which is attached to the surface or roof and is manoeuvrable by pivoting with respect thereto whilst remaining attached thereto, between a stowed condition and an exercising condition.

Pull cable resistance mechanism in a treadmill
10569121 · 2020-02-25 · ·

A treadmill may include a deck, a first pulley disposed in a first portion of the deck, a second pulley disposed in a second portion of the deck, a tread belt surrounding the first pulley and the second pulley, an upright structure connected to the deck, and a pull cable incorporated into the upright structure.

Flip and dip handle system for performing dip exercises on an exercise machine
10532244 · 2020-01-14 · ·

An exercise machine for performing dip exercises, having: a stationary main frame; first and second mounting brackets connected to the stationary main frame; first and second dip handle assemblies connected to the mounting brackets, each dip handle assembly having a first exercise arm, a first stop plate, and a first arm mount hub, wherein the first and second dip handle assemblies are each configured to be converted between an exercise position and a storage position while connected to the exercise machine.

Weightlifting Assembly And Weight Rack Including Weightlifting Assembly

An adjustable carriage assembly is configured to be mounted on a frame member of a weight rack and includes a moveable carriage with a plurality of rollers that engage the frame member, as well as a connection structure for connection of an articulating implement. A releasable pin is mounted on the carriage proximate to a rear of the carriage and has an arm configured for engagement to move the releasable pin. The releasable pin is moveable by axial translation between a locked position and an unlocked position to selectively engage the frame member to lock the carriage in position or permit movement of the carriage. A removable pin may be removably received through a pin hole in the carriage to extend through the passage in a direction perpendicular to a direction of axial translation of the releasable pin, to engage the frame member to prevent movement of the carriage.

EXERCISE EQUIPMENT
20240082633 · 2024-03-14 ·

A leg exercise apparatus installable on an upright. The apparatus includes a fixing system installable on the upright and an arm extending along a first direction and hinged to the fixing system so as to be rotatable relative to a hinge axis. The apparatus further includes a first push roller mounted on one side of the arm, a rod for holding weights, and a support for supporting the rod at a first distance from the arm. The support is mounted on the arm.

Training system
11896863 · 2024-02-13 · ·

Disclosed is a training system. The training system may include a base, a plurality of gussets, a support frame, a plurality of connectors, and a plurality of locking pins. The plurality of gussets may define a plurality of adjustment holes. The support frame may include first and second support members and a crossbar. The first and second support members may be connected to the base via the plurality of gussets. The plurality of connectors may be distributed about the base and along the crossbar. The plurality of locking pins may be sized to fit the plurality of adjustment holes to lock the support frame in one of a plurality of angled positions relative to the base.

Exercise machine having elastic exercise resistance cables

An exercise machine includes an upright mounting assembly having a top and a bottom spaced-apart from the top. The exercise machine includes a seat operatively connected to the upright mounting assembly. The exercise machine includes a first pair of space-apart pulley assemblies rotatably mounted adjacent to the top of the upright mounting assembly. The exercise machine includes a second pair of spaced-apart pulley assemblies rotatably mounted adjacent to the bottom of the upright mounting assembly. The exercise machine includes a plurality of exercise resistance cables connected at proximal end portions to the upright mounting assembly and extending around and outward, respectively, from the first and second pairs of spaced-apart pulley assemblies.
